Live-eviL Recruitment Center / Tools Programmer here
« on: April 11, 2006, 12:17:25 am »
any need for a live-evil programmer to write custom timing/translating/encoding software.

ive been experimenting with microphone controled timing.  voice recognition to auto set subtitles and times (times are automatically "stickied" to areas of peaked audio levels in the raw)  this is still experimental though.  another tool ive written is a clap timer (yup like clap on lighting :) )  so you can time a file by loading in a text file with all the translated subs, then claping to start and stop.  the next avilable subtitle is loaded up when you clap , and its end time is set when you clap again.

timing while lying in bed watching anime!
